So, 'Sun Moon' is this really introspective piece set in Taiwan, following Kelsey, who's dealing with some heavy stuff—failure and heartbreak. The pacing feels deliberate, almost meditative, allowing the audience to immerse themselves in Kelsey's journey of self-discovery. The cinematography captures Taiwan beautifully, blending the vibrant culture with Kelsey's internal struggles. The performances, especially from Kelsey, are raw and sincere, adding depth to her crisis of faith. It’s not just about romance; it grapples with those bigger questions of purpose and belief. The practical effects are minimal, but they serve the narrative well, keeping the focus on character rather than spectacle. There’s a certain quiet power in its storytelling.
